• <br />PROCLAMATION <br />DESIGNATING THE MONTH OF APRIL, 2002 AS <br />NATIONAL CHILD ABUSE PREVENTION MONTH <br />IN INDIAN RIVER COUNTY <br />WHEREAS, child abuse is a serious and growing problem affecting over 3,620 children on <br />the Treasure Coast, 75,000 children in the state of Florida annually, and more than 3.2 million <br />nationally, including more than 1,000 abuse -related tragic fatalities; and <br />WHEREAS, this societal malignancy known as child abuse respects no racial, religious, <br />class or geographic boundaries and, in fact, has been declared a national emergency; and <br />WHEREAS, every child deserves to live in a safe. permanent and caring family, knowing that <br />children from stable, healthy home environments are better prepared for school, have a significantly <br />better academic future and are less likely to become involved in drugs and crime; and <br />WHEREAS, the CASTLE of the Treasure Coast, incorporated in 1981 as the Exchange Club <br />Center for the Prevention of Child Abuse of the Treasure Coast, Inc., was the first center in the <br />country created for the sole purpose of bringing awareness to, and breaking the cycle of, child abuse, <br />qnd has become the model for a network of over 100 such agencies throughout 27 states, all working <br />win the battle against the devastating pain and lifelong results of child abuse; and <br />WHEREAS, the CASTLE (which stands for Child Abuse Services, Training and Life <br />Enrichment) through its support of parent aide programs, parenting classes, educational programs <br />and community service activities is making significant progress in stopping this crime against families <br />and children. <br />N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T PROCLAIMED BY THE INDIAN RIVER COUNTY BOARD OF <br />COUNTY COMMISSIONERS that the month of April, 2002, be designated as <br />NATIONAL CHILD ABUSE PREVENTION MONTH <br />in Indian River County, and all citizens are urged to use this time to reflect upon, better understand, <br />recognize and respond to this grievous crime against defenseless children. <br />Adopted this 2nd day of April, 2002. <br />BOARD OF COUNTY COMMISSIONERS <br />INDIAN RIVER COUNTY, FLORIDA <br />Ruth M.
